329.153 Policy on prevention and cost-effective programs and strategies.


OR Rev Stat § 329.153 (through Leg Sess 2011) What's This?

(1) It is the policy of the Legislative Assembly that programs and strategies that can substantiate a claim to prevention and cost-effectiveness be of high priority.

(2) The Legislative Assembly finds that dollars invested in quality programs, such as the Head Start program after which the Oregon prekindergarten is modeled, return the costs thereof several times over in costs saved in the areas of remedial education, corrections and human services.
